Why Healthcare Apps Are Developing So Fast


The pace of development of healthcare apps is unprecedented. Patients want immediate care. Sellers drive towards cost reductions. It is possible with the help of digital tools.


Remote care is now normal.


Wearables monitors vital signs and transmits them in real-time to physicians.

Predictive analytics can identify risks in advance.


But there are challenges with this growth. Developers should come up with applications that are user-friendly, secure, and regulation-friendly. Technology is not as significant as trust.

AI Diagnostics: Scale Accuracy


One of the key forces shaping digital healthcare market trends is artificial intelligence working alongside biotechnology. This combination is no longer experimental. It is practical, validated, and increasingly necessary in modern care.


Why It Matters


  • Speed. AI can scan thousands of images within seconds, especially when paired with biotechnology-driven imaging and lab data.

  • Consistency. Algorithms never get tired and miss details.

  • Scalability. A single system can be used by physicians in a large number of clinics.


How AI Works in Apps


  • Recognition of tumours, fractures or lung problems.

  • Predictive analytics to predict risks such as sepsis or heart failure.

  • Symptom checkers which direct the patient to the appropriate care.


Challenges Developers Face


  • Bias. Poorly trained models can give unequal results.

  • Regulatory approval. FDA or EMA need to first approve numerous tools.

  • Trust. Patients should feel that AI is on the side of doctors and not doctors themselves.


The most effective applications make AI a second pair of eyes. Physicians make final calls, and AI identifies anomalies. This bifurcated model is accurate, safe and accountable.



Personalization and Patient-Centred Design


Personalization is another strong digital healthcare market trend. Patients are now demanding healthcare applications to be as personalized as e-commerce or streaming

applications.


Basic Tenets of Patient-Centred Design:


  • Simplicity. Easy navigation and tension free use.

  • Accessibility. Voice recognition, font settings and multilinguality.

  • Privacy. Clear policies and patient consent were part of the flow.


How Personalization Works


  • Adjustable medication reminders.

  • Condition-specific adaptive content, such as diet advice about diabetes or air quality warnings about asthma.

  • Wearable integration to draw real-time heart rate, sleep or activity data.



Development Challenges


  • Data overload. Patients are bombarded with too many alerts.

  • Interoperability. The apps should be able to be connected with EHRs, wearables, and labs.

  • Balance. The personalization should not restrict autonomy among the patients.


The personalization creates loyalty when it is done effectively. Patients do not stop using the app because of a compulsion, but rather due to its relevance, supportiveness, and personal ownership.

As digital-first care scales, hospitals must operationalise rules that extend beyond HIPAA—especially the 340B Drug Pricing Program. Health systems are adopting compliance software to automate 100% auditing of 340B transactions, centralize documentation, and coordinate pharmacy, finance, and compliance teams. This reduces leakage and audit risk while preserving savings that fund patient services. For app developers, integrating with a 340B-ready compliance layer ensures clean data flows, defensible audit trails, and faster go-lives across telemedicine and pharmacy workflows.
